Modular, highly flexible spring production with the “Multi-FMU 32”
The new “Multi-FMU 32” is a modular machine for the production of extension springs with extended loops. The “Multi-FMU 32” follows the modular system of the “BQ 10”, the transfer bending machine for bent wire parts. Once the spring body has been produced using either the coiling or winding method, there are further bending stations for producing the loops. They can be arranged flexibly to suit the spring geometry and customer's requirements. A transfer system transfers the springs from one station to the next. At the “Innovation Days”, the “Multi-FMU 32” will demonstrate the production of extended loops, with the extension spring body being wound around the mandrel.

One advantage of the modular structure is the great flexibility of the machine. The number and function of the workstations is freely configurable and can be adjusted to suit the specific requirement. In addition to extension springs with extended loops, it is also possible to produce springs with machine (German) and crossover (English) loops on the machine.

"The ‘FMU’ has established itself over the last twenty years as the standard for flexible production of torsion springs. The ‘Multi-FMU’ combines the great flexibility and easy programming of the ‘FMU’ with the high productivity of traditional mechanical multi-station machines, for example the well-known ‘FSO 3’ or ‘ASF/BSF’. In the future, another variant will follow as the successor to the ‘ZO 4/ZO 41’ and ‘ZO 42’ and the ‘ZOS 3/4’ and ‘ASF 4/BSF 4-S’," says Dr. Uwe-Peter Weigmann, Speaker of the Board at Wafios.

Large quantities in the production of bent parts from wire and tube
The “BQ 10” will be another modular machine on display. It is a CNC transfer bending machine for wire diameters of between 3 mm and 10 mm. The machine can process round and profiled wire. The machine on display has four stations with modules for bending, forming, flattening and die cutting. In addition, a thread roller can be integrated between the feed module and the wall. This is perfect for producing a whole family of components.

"Several work steps can proceed simultaneously with the different stations. Carrying out production in parallel results in a high output rate," says Jörg Eisele, member of the Board at Wafios. A patent has been filed for the freely programmable transfer system with a modular structure and it will be demonstrated at the Innovation Days with five CNC single transfer modules.

They can each be programmed individually and independently of each other. The stations can be installed offset to the original position. Thanks to the programmable CNC axes, the single transfer system also offers quick adjustment to new positions within existing programs.

The monitored 3-channel sorting device
The new sorting device will show on the “FUL” series what a modern 3-channel sorting device is capable of. The sorting device is motor-driven and electrically controlled. Maximum reliability in the sorting process is achieved by monitoring the position of the flaps. During the correct sorting process, the dropping behavior of the springs is monitored by sensors. This increases production reliability because it prevents springs from jamming or an incorrectly positioned flap. Automatic setting of the delay time as a function of the drop time also ensures a smooth and reliable setup process.

Speed mode for compression springs
The “FUL 76” is able to adjust the axis parameters automatically based on the required spring specification. The spring coiling machine can optimize the feed speed on its own, based on the wire diameter, spring index and tensile strength, depending on whether a higher feed speed is required, e.g. for small wire diameters, or a maximum force for large wire diameters. As a result, for small outer spring diameters or large spring indices, an up to 13% higher output can be achieved by dynamic axis parameters. The machine switches to "speed mode" so to speak.

Setting up new parts easily with the “Wafios Assistant”
At the “wire 2024”, Wafios unveiled its assisted machines, such as the “BM 36 HS” wire bending machine, for the first time. "We received very positive feedback from the market. This showed us that we're on the right path," says Dr. Weigmann. A new requirement is logging assistance processes for individual customers. The result is the new “Wafios Assistant”, which will be unveiled to the world for the first time at the “Innovation Days”.

The “Wafios Assistant” guides the operator through the process of setting up new parts and assists inexperienced users with instructions, images and videos. This will make it much easier to set up complex parts as well. In addition to the setup processes provided by Wafios, operators now have the option to create their own, individual assistance processes and so help to ensure that the machines are set up consistently within the company. The company's internal know-how is easy to multiply with the “Wafios Assistant”. It will then ensure consistent programming processes. This will improve the level of quality and production reliability, while also ensuring that the company's internal know-how does not leave the company. The individual assistance processes remain within the company. "We're thus fulfilling a long-standing requirement to protect our customers' know-how, and it's also easier to share knowledge within the company," says Dr. Weigmann.

Continuous improvement in quality during straightening
At the “Innovation Days”, the “R 36” will be presented with the new rod position detection option in conjunction with the end working device “EBF”. Especially when producing rods with chamfered ends, length deviations can be seen directly on the product. The end working device “EBF” is equipped with sensors that are attached to both end working units and optically record the position of the rod ends during clamping. Based on these positions, the control unit calculates the feed values required for the desired chamfers and transfers them to the corresponding feed rates for the chamfering spindles. This compensates for any differences in length caused by temperature or cutting tolerances and produces continuous chamfers. This results in a continuous improvement in quality, reliable chamfering, shorter setup times and fewer rejects.

Wide range of variants in the production of busbars
Whether they are used in purely electric or hybrid vehicles, busbars are a key technology in e-mobility today. But the requirements differ enormously. They range from a small manoeuvrable car with little space to busbars for a truck with large conductor cross-sections. Wafios machines can cover a wide range of different variants. At the “Innovation Days”, three different machine concepts adapted to the needs of the manufacturers will be presented.

The “BMF 90” busbar machine can process material up to a maximum of 200mm², depending on the material specification and the ratio of the cross-section. The specially designed and patented bending tool allows the smallest bending radii with minimum bending distances while always maintaining the highest quality. Mechanical insulation stripping can also be integrated on the “BMF 90”. Mechanical insulation stripping is a cost-effective alternative to the CO2 laser and helps to reduce the cycle times by 40% or more.

For long, three-dimensional busbars with asymmetric geometries, Wafios will be presenting the new “BTF 90”, a groundbreaking machine concept, as a prototype for the first time. It combines the well-known geometry of the double-head wire bending machine from the “BT” series with the “BMF 90”. The “BTF” expands the options for the BMF technology from smaller and medium-sized busbars to long busbars for cross-sections of up to 200mm². In addition, it offers the option to process pre-assembled material from a magazine. The flexible “BTF” can be adjusted to suit requirements and extends from the production of prototypes to series production.

One highlight is the newly developed transfer system with a gripper feed unit that will be presented for the first time at the “Innovation Days”.

The “Twister²” provides new possibilities for the production of long busbars with large conductor cross-sections of up to 400mm². The tools from the tube section prevent surface deformations and at the same time provide sufficient bending moment to bend busbars flat wise as well as edge wise. The large range of machines for the production of busbars enables Wafios to cater for customer-specific requirements, such as short bending distances, long lengths, different cross-sections, high output rates, different insulation stripping procedures and the integration of further process steps.

New loading concept and support with tool changes
A number of innovations in relation to traditional tube bending will also be presented. One of them is the “Top Bend 35”, a complete right/left tube bending machine for entry into the market. It offers a very high operating speed thanks to its performance optimized design, maximum energy efficiency with its state-of-the-art drive technology and a modular machine concept. As a less expensive variant, the “Top Bend” is also available as an “Eco” version with just one bending direction. The second bending direction can be retrofitted at any time.

The machine will be presented with the new tube magazine with CNC loading unit for the first time at the Wafios “Innovation Days”.

The newly developed loading concept consists of a tube magazine and an additional CNC-controlled loading arm system that is arranged between the magazine and the bending machine. One advantage of this system is that the picking-up position can be freely chosen to be in the rear or front area. As the tube material for the bending machine is already provided within the non-productive time, this also produces optimized cycle times.

The “Top Bend 100” has been developed for large tube diameters. It is a tube bending machine for tube diameters up to 100mm x 4mm and can be configured flexibly. The flexible configuration will be visualized with a new digital concept at the exhibition. The Wafios programming software “WPS 3.2 Easy Way” is continuing to evolve. One new feature of the software is automatic compensation for radius deviations. The software calculates the radius increases that occur during bending on the basis of the material data and adjusts the geometry of the component. This means that the operator obtains a good part that is true to gauge faster.
